Is Louis Vuitton Publicly Traded?
Louis Vuitton, as a brand, is not publicly traded on its own. Instead, it operates under the umbrella of LVMH, which is a publicly traded company on the Paris stock exchange. LVMH's ownership of Louis Vuitton and other luxury brands allows investors to gain exposure to the thriving luxury goods industry through a single investment vehicle.
